justy 46 Posted July 7, 2011 Posted July 7, 2011 If you think about it tough,the only reason Britains upped there standards lately was to try and compete with UH & REPLICAGRI. But still be cheaper at the same time, & try and strike a balance between the carpet farmer and the collector. Back in the 70's and 80's when Britains produced the MF 590, their only competition were Corgi & LoneStar i spose. So they were the best back then by a mile. But starting to improve again with those IH & CASE models. Quote
